  • This video shares with you some of the great diversity of Kasanka's habitats and its abundant animal life. Kasanka National Park, at some 400 square km, is one of the smallest conservation areas in Zambia. This video was produced in 2004, since then David Lloyd died, the "yellow race of the savanna baboon" has been upgraded to a full species: Kinda baboon and Shoebill camp is now part of the Bangweulu Conservation Area administered by African Parks.
